Betting tips Formula 1 World Championship: Understanding the Basics
Before placing your bets, it’s essential to grasp the fundamental aspects of Formula 1 racing. Each race weekend consists of practice sessions, qualifying, and the race itself, all of which can influence the betting landscape. Key factors to consider include:
- Driver Performance: Analyze recent performances, including podium finishes and qualifying speeds.
- Team Dynamics: Understand the strengths and weaknesses of teams, as well as their historical performance at specific circuits.
- Track Conditions: Weather can dramatically affect race outcomes, so keep an eye on forecasts.
For example, if Lewis Hamilton is racing at a track where he has historically performed well, consider placing a bet on him to finish in the top three. If the odds are around 2.50 for a top three finish and you wager $100, a successful bet would yield a profit of $150.

Betting tips Formula 1 World Championship: Advanced Strategies
Once you’re familiar with the basics, it’s time to implement more advanced betting strategies. Here are some effective approaches:
- Value Betting: Look for odds that seem mispriced. For instance, if a driver has odds of 4.00 to win but you estimate their true chances at 20%, that’s a value bet.
- Live Betting: Utilize in-race betting opportunities to take advantage of changing dynamics. For example, if a favored driver is trailing early but is known for strong comebacks, consider betting on them as odds shift.
- Prop Bets: Explore propositions such as “Which driver will set the fastest lap?” This can be lucrative, especially for drivers known for their speed on particular tracks.
Remember to manage your bankroll effectively. A common strategy is the 1-2% rule, where you only wager 1-2% of your total bankroll on a single bet to mitigate risks.
